The frustrating Tottenham career of Giovani do Santos could finally be coming to an end in this
transfer window with reports of interest from Spain and from Bolton Wanderers boss Owen Coyle. Gio
hinted at his potential again this month, albeit against Cheltenham, and after the game manager
Harry Redknapp hailed his talent while giving an insight into why the player has barely featured at
the Lane.

Neil Warnock's sacking at QPR could have some implications for Spurs' winter transfer plans if
the new Loftus Road manager is given a transfer kitty worth up to £20m. Last week, Rangers are
reported to have offered £5m for Christopher Samba while Warnock was still at the club and it's
thought that the Congolese centre half remains a priority.

In a decision that was undoubtably cheered at the FA's headquarters, a jury today cleared Spurs
manager Harry Redknapp and former Portsmouth chairman Milan Mandaric of tax evasion.
Speaking on the steps of Southwark Crown Court, Redknapp said the case "should never have come
to court".

Swiss starlet Granit Xhaka is unlikely to move to the Premier League this summer after revealing
that he is close to joining German side Borussia Monchengladbach.
Xhaka, who plays for Basel, impressed during the Swiss side's run to the last 16 of the Champions
League this season, reportedly attracting the interest of suitors such as Liverpool.
